Building AI agents with Claude in Amazon Bedrock | Code w/ Claude

Building AI agents with Claude in Amazon Bedrock | Code w/ Claude

In a presentation from Code w/ Claude, AWS advocates Du'An Lightfoot, Suman Debnath, and Banjo Obayami introduce Strands, a new open-source Python SDK for building AI agentic applications on AWS. They showcase how Strands simplifies development by focusing on three core components—models, tools, and prompts—and leverages the full reasoning power of foundation models like Claude 3.5 on Amazon Bedrock. The session includes live demos on creating a multi-tool weather agent, integrating with Modular Connected Protocol (MCP) servers for AWS documentation and diagram generation, and using Claude Code to auto-generate a complete Strands agent for AWS CDK.
